The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s requiring Manual Testing sk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 7 January 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
7 Jan 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 512 493 526
Rank change year-on-year -19 +33 -29
Permanent jobs citing Manual Testing 130 217 197
As % of all permanent jobs in the UK 0.22% 0.40% 0.37%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 0.27% 0.44% 0.41%
Number of salaries quoted 95 131 170
10th Percentile £33,750 £31,925 £33,975
25th Percentile £42,500 £41,625 £40,875
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£52,000 £50,000 £50,000
Median % change year-on-year +4.00% - -0.99%
75th Percentile £62,500 £65,000 £57,500
90th Percentile £70,750 £77,500 £73,300
UK excluding London median annual salary £47,500 £47,500 £45,000
% change year-on-year - +5.56% -10.00%
